Revelation
Directed byAndré van Heerden
Directed by
André van Heerden
Thorold Stone, a police officer in search for answers, joins a rebel group of Christians to thwart the Antichrist's plan to use virtual reality to solidify its power.
bible
religion
messiah
Last Updated: 5 days ago



























